An exciting opportunity exists for an experienced or trainee Respiratory Scientist with a strong interest in respiratory physiology and commitment to high quality respiratory measurement to join the team at RespACT in our nation’s capital Canberra, ACT. There is a potential opportunity for an experienced Respiratory Scientist to move up to a senior scientist role in the future. RespACT is a busy private Canberra based lung function laboratory operating out of two sites (Phillip and Bruce). We will be opening a third site in the coming months. Employment Type: Permanent Part time (0.5 to 0.8 FTE) Hours Per Week: minimum 20hrs/week Remuneration: Dependent upon experience $35 to $42/hr (health professionals and support award 2024) Position: Respiratory Scientist Qualifications (Required): BSc, BappSc or Equivalent 1-year minimum experience in Respiratory Science. CRFS recommended. Immediate Supervisor: Senior Scientist / Manager Responsible to: Directors of RespACT Responsibilities and duties include: Conduct complex lung function tests including spirometry, gas transfer, static lung volumes, FeNO, respiratory muscle strength testing, bronchial provocation tests, and 6-minute walk tests and oximetry screening. Computer and administration skills including patient booking and taking payments on the day of testing (our practice uses Gentu Medical software). Quality assurance including calibration and equipment maintenance. Demonstrated ability to work in a team environment whilst working independently to deliver results within specified timeframes set to meet client expectations. Mandatory requirements: Completed undergraduate/postgraduate degree in science with a strong component in human and/or respiratory physiology. Current certification in CPR/advanced first aid. Working with children/vulnerable people certificate. Prior experience in respiratory diagnostics is highly desirable.
